2009-09-16 114 views
1

我有兩個表命名模塊和特權,它們通過外鍵關係如下圖所示相關:實體框架模型多表到單個實體

alt text

我想模型模塊和特權通過將ModuleName添加到特權。稍後我會對從Privilege創建派生類(插圖中的Menu)感興趣,方法是在ModuleName上添加一個區分條件。這可能使用實體框架?

回答

1

您可以將多個表映射到單個實體類型嗎? Sure, that is supported.但是,不能使用表(ModuleName)的映射字段作爲每個層次結構映射的表的鑑別器列。鑑別器列必須僅用作鑑別器,並且不得映射到客戶端模式中。